Background
A wither skeleton is a variant of a skeleton. The following is a picture of what a wither skeleton looks like in the game:

| Hostility Level | Hostile Mob |
|---|---|
| Health Points | 20 health points |
| Where to Find | In the Nether |
| Weapon | Stone Sword |
| Attack Method | Strikes you with a stone sword and gives you the Wither effect for 10 seconds |
| Drops | 0-2 Bones 0-2 Coal 0-1 Stone Sword 0-1 Wither Skeleton Skull (rare) |
| Experience Points | 5 experience points |
Hostility Level (Hostile)
A wither skeleton is a hostile mob. The term mob is short for mobile and is used to refer to all living, moving creatures in the game such as chickens, creepers, and wither skeletons. Because a wither skeleton is a hostile mob, it will attack you in Survival mode but not Creative mode.
Health Points
In Minecraft, a wither skeleton has 10 hearts
for health. This gives a wither skeleton 20 health points (because 1 heart = 2 health points). To kill a wither skeleton, you need to inflict 20 points of damage to the wither skeleton.

Where to Find Wither Skeletons
In Minecraft, you can find wither skeletons in the Nether. Wither skeletons are the Nether’s version of a skeleton. While an Overworld skeleton carries a bow and arrow, a wither skeleton from the Nether carries a stone sword.

Weapon
The wither skeleton is armed with a stone sword as a weapon.

Attack Method
In Minecraft, a wither skeleton will move towards you and try to strike you with its stone sword when it attacks. If it hits you with its sword, you will get the Wither effect for 10 seconds. You can drink milk to remove this effect immediately or wait 10 seconds for the Wither effect to wear off.
Drops
When you kill a wither skeleton in Minecraft, it may drop one or more of the following items: bones, coal or a stone sword. And in rare circumstances, a wither skeleton may drop a wither skeleton skull.

Experience Points
As you play the game, you will gain experience. The most common way to gain experience is by killing mobs. When a mob is killed you will see tiny green and yellow balls appear and move towards you.

These orbs represent experience points. When you kill a wither skeleton, you will gain 5 experience points.
